Section 13C. The secretary of the executive office shall establish rates of payment for health care services; provided, that the secretary may designate another governmental unit to perform such ratemaking functions. The secretary of the executive office shall have the responsibility for establishing rates to be paid to providers for health care services by governmental units, including the division of industrial accidents. The rates shall be adequate to meet the costs incurred by efficiently and economically operated facilities providing care and services in conformity with applicable state and federal laws and regulations and quality and safety standards and which are within the financial capacity of the commonwealth.
